Question to the Department for International Development:

To ask the Secretary of State for International Development, how many of her Department's projects involve indigenous communities in (a) all and (b) Commonwealth rainforests.

All of DFID's bilateral forestry programmes, and the multilateral forestry programmes DFID supports, include the participation of forest-dependent communities who are often indigenous people.

These programmes cover the following 6 Commonwealth rainforest countries: Belize, Cameroon, Ghana, Guyana, Papua New Guinea, and Uganda.
